The top baby names in America for 2011 have been released, with the usual popular choices included. While last year’s official Irish figures have not been yet published, there are some interesting correlations between popular names in Ireland in 2010 and current favorite names in America.

For girls, Sophia came out as the favorite in America, while Sophie, a derivative of the name, was most popular in Ireland in 2010 with almost 600 parents choosing the name. Sophie has been in the top five list three times since 1998 – in 2006, 2007, and 2009.

Despite the prevalence of Irish baby names here in America, Liam and Aiden were the only Irish names to make it onto the top baby names in the U.S. for 2011.

Both Sofia and Lilly feature in the US top 20 list, perhaps demonstrating the American influence on Ireland, these two names were first time entries to the top 100 names for Irish baby girls in 2010.
